Market Overview:


The global radio frequency inductors market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 6.5% during the forecast period from 2018 to 2030. The market growth can be attributed to the increasing demand for miniaturized and high-frequency components in consumer electronics and automotive applications. Additionally, the growing demand for RF inductors in communication systems is also propelling the growth of this market. Based on type, the global radio frequency inductors market can be segmented into wire wound type, film type, and multilayer type. The wire wound type segment is expected to account for a major share of the global RF inductor market during the forecast period owing to its superior performance characteristics as compared to other types of RF inductors. By application, mobile phone accounted for a majority share of the global RF inductor market in 2017 and is projected to maintain its dominance duringthe forecast period due toof rising demand from emerging economies such as China and India .

Product Definition:


A Radio Frequency Inductor is a passive electronic component that is used in circuits to manage and control the flow of electrical current. RF inductors are important components in many types of electronic equipment, including radios, televisions, and cell phones. They are used to create specific frequencies or channels within a circuit and help to keep the signal clear and consistent.

Application Insights:


The radio frequency inductors are used in mobile phones, consumer electronics, automotive and communication systems among other applications. In terms of revenue, the mobile phone application segment dominated the global market with a share of over 40% in 2017. The growing demand for smartphones is expected to drive this segment over the forecast period. Radio frequency inductors are also used in wireless routers, modems and network interface cards (NICs). These devices require low power consumption and high performance as compared to traditional electronic circuits that use electromechanical relays or solid-state relays (ESR).


The product plays an important role in various consumer electronics products such as set-top boxes (STB), digital televisions (DTV), smartwatches & wearables devices among others.


Regional Analysis:


North America dominated the global market in 2017. The U.S., which is at the forefront, has been witnessing a surge in demand for 4G/LTE-enabled smartphones and tablets coupled with growing adoption of next-generation wireless services (NGW) infrastructure. This trend is expected to continue over the forecast period, thereby driving regional growth.


The Asia Pacific region accounted for a revenue share of more than 25% in 2017 owing to increasing demand from developing countries such as India and China along with Japan and South Korea due to rising disposable income, changing lifestyles, technological advancements along with increased penetration of international players operating under their home country’s brand name are some factors responsible for regional growth.
